Mr. Dale is copresenting Workshop W8, “Survival Strategies for Home Builders and Residential Developers,” on Wednesday afternoon. He is president and chief executive officer of DBH Resources, Inc. (DBHR), which provides risk-management consulting services to high-risk industries and the insurers that insure them.

Mr. Dale provides overall strategic direction for the corporation. In addition, he acts as the primary outreach on legislative and insurance coverage issues. He serves on the Board of Directors of the California Building Industry Association. Mr. Dale is also a member of the organization’s Evaluation & Strategic Planning and Member Services committees, the Risk Management & Insurance Subcommittee and the Strategic Plan Implementation Team. He also served as the chair of the Construction Dispute Resolution Task Force, which helped negotiate SB 800, landmark construction defect reform legislation in California.

Mr. Dale is a frequent speaker on insurance management and business risk prevention. He has appeared in Business Insurance Magazine, Builder and Developer Magazine, the Orange County Register, The Los Angeles Times, and the Los Angeles, Orange County and San Fernando Valley Business Journals, as both an author and a quoted source on issues related to law and risk management.

Mr. Dale earned his B.A. degree from the University of California, Irvine, and his J.D. degree, magna cum laude, in 1985 from Southwestern University in Los Angeles. His civil litigation law practice encompassed insurance coverage, professional liability, and construction law. He tried many cases to verdict and has several reported appellate decisions.
